Houthi advance on Bab al-Mandeb displaces 46,000 in Yemen
A new Houthi offensive toward the Bab al-Mandeb strait has displaced at least 46,000 people since last week, per IOM. The advance threatens a critical chokepoint for global shipping, though the extent of territorial gains remains unverified. This escalation could disrupt Red Sea transit and regional stability.

Yemen: Houthi Forces Seize Mokha Port, Advance on Bab al-Mandeb
Houthi forces have seized the strategic Red Sea port of Mokha and are advancing towards the Bab al-Mandeb Strait, consolidating control over key coastal areas. This territorial shift, corroborated by multiple sources, significantly escalates the Yemen conflict and threatens global maritime security. The full extent of Houthi control over Al-Hudaydah province and the immediate impact on shipping remain partially unconfirmed.
